How Common Is The Last Name Vipers? popularity and diffusion
This last name is the 2,555,468th most widely held surname world-wide, held by approximately 1 in 127,851,683 people. The surname occurs predominantly in Europe, where 81 percent of Vipers reside; 79 percent reside in Northern Europe and 79 percent reside in British Isles.
This surname is most widely held in England, where it is carried by 45 people, or 1 in 1,238,179. In England Vipers is primarily found in: Surrey, where 36 percent are found, Hertfordshire, where 22 percent are found and Lincolnshire, where 16 percent are found. Not including England this last name is found in 8 countries. It is also found in The United States, where 9 percent are found and Australia, where 2 percent are found.
Vipers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The occurrence of Vipers has changed through the years. In England the share of the population with the surname grew 205 percent between 1881 and 2014.
